The Vicious Vet (Agatha Raisin #2)
by M.C. Beaton - 2/5

Reading this book proved to be a forgettable business. The author must have been inspired at the beginning and might have had severe bouts of writer's block at about the middle, where the plot began to run out of steam. IT's sensible to acknowledge that any decently written cozy looks exciting in the beginning. That's because the fan of the genre knows that the pieces on the board are being arranged and soon there will be murder, mayhem, suspects, wash rinse repeat.

The exact moment of me losing interest in The Vicious Vet was from the break in. From that moment, the book lost me. I also happen to think that on paper, the entire motives and hidden events of the murderer and his accomplice was humane enough. It's just that the author didn't fully tug on our collective heartstrings. There was some wasted potential there. I know lots of people must have enjoyed this book. But as someone who doesn't excuse uninspired writing and let it pass for 'fluff' or 'harmless fun', I must say I was disappointed. The only strong image left from spending three days with the book was where James was in the disco, waving his arms about and making his way towards a suspect. That was priceless. The book itself, not so much.
